摘要
This review compiles recent research and developments on the metal-ligand coordinated charged vesicles. focusing on the phase behavior, properties. microstructures, and vesicle-phases of metal-ligand complexation as templating preparation of inorganic nanoparticles. Moreover, the other kind of salt-free vesicles, constructed by the electrostatic interaction with zero-charged ones were simply also compared with those constructed by the metal-ligand coordinated complexes with charged molecular membranes in the properties, the phase behaviors, and the microstructures.
